Highfill is a city located in the United States, specifically in Benton County, Arkansas. Its GPS coordinates are 36.26147, -94.35771, placing it in the northwest region of the state. Highfill operates within the America/Chicago timezone, aligning its time with Central Standard Time.
The city is known for its proximity to the Northwest Arkansas Regional Airport, which contributes to its significance as a transportation hub in the region. Highfill’s location also positions it near various recreational opportunities, including parks and trails, which attract both residents and visitors. Additionally, the city is part of the rapidly growing economic area surrounding Bentonville and Rogers, contributing to its regional importance.
Timezone in Highfill
Highfill is located in the Central Time Zone of the United States, specifically under the America/Chicago timezone. This timezone has a standard UTC offset of -6 hours. During daylight saving time, which begins on the second Sunday in March and ends on the first Sunday in November, the offset changes to UTC -5 hours.
This means that clocks are set forward by one hour in spring and set back in autumn. When considering the time difference with other regions in the United States, it’s important to note that Highfill operates on Central Standard Time, which is one hour behind Eastern Standard Time. This can affect communication and business operations, as those in New York or Washington, D.C. will be an hour ahead.

Practical Information for Visitors
Highfill is conveniently served by the Northwest Arkansas National Airport, which is just a short drive away. This airport offers flights from major airlines, making it accessible for travelers. If you prefer ground transport, consider renting a car to explore the surrounding areas, as public transport options are limited.
The weather in Highfill is characterized by a humid subtropical climate, with hot summers and mild winters. Average summer temperatures can reach the high 80s to low 90s Fahrenheit, while winter temperatures typically range from the mid-30s to low 50s. The best time to visit is during the spring and fall months when temperatures are more moderate, and you can enjoy the beautiful natural scenery.
